Discovering Alleppey in One Day

  1. 9:00 AM: Alleppey Beach
    Located 10 minutes (2.3 km) from the city center

    Start your day by visiting Alleppey Beach, a serene and scenic spot where you can relax and soak up the sun. Take a leisurely stroll along the shore or simply enjoy the breathtaking views of the Arabian Sea.

  2. 10:30 AM: Nehru Trophy Boat Race
    15 minutes (5.2 km) from Alleppey Beach

    Experience the thrill of the Nehru Trophy Boat Race, a popular annual event held in Alleppey. Watch as ornately decorated snake boats compete against each other in a fierce race. The atmosphere is electrifying and offers a unique cultural experience.

  3. 12:00 PM: Alleppey Backwaters
    30 minutes (19.7 km) from Nehru Trophy Boat Race

    Embark on a mesmerizing journey through the famed backwaters of Alleppey. Cruise along the tranquil canals, lined with lush greenery and traditional houseboats. Immerse yourself in the scenic beauty and experience the serene ambiance of this enchanting destination.

  4. 2:00 PM: Krishnapuram Palace
    1 hour (39.5 km) from Alleppey Backwaters

    Discover the grandeur of Krishnapuram Palace, a magnificent historical site showcasing traditional Kerala architecture. Admire the stunning murals, antique artifacts, and the beautiful garden surrounding the palace. It offers a fascinating glimpse into the region's rich history and culture.

  5. 4:00 PM: Alappuzha Lighthouse
    25 minutes (13.7 km) from Krishnapuram Palace

    Visit the Alappuzha Lighthouse, a striking red-and-white structure that provides panoramic views of the surrounding area. Climb to the top for a breathtaking vista of the city, backwaters, and the Arabian Sea. Enjoy the cool breeze and capture memorable photos.

  6. 5:30 PM: Alleppey Canals
    20 minutes (9.4 km) from Alappuzha Lighthouse

    Explore the picturesque Alleppey Canals, also known as Venice of the East. Take a leisurely boat ride through the narrow canals, witnessing the local life and charming village scenery along the way. It's a perfect way to relax and enjoy the natural beauty.

  7. 7:00 PM: Alleppey Market
    15 minutes (5.9 km) from Alleppey Canals

    End your day at the bustling Alleppey Market, where you can experience the local culture and shop for souvenirs. Taste delicious street food and interact with friendly locals. The market offers a vibrant atmosphere that encapsulates the essence of Alleppey.

Recommendations

If you have extra time, consider visiting the Marari Beach for its tranquil surroundings or exploring the Pathiramanal Island, a scenic birdwatching spot. For a day trip, you can visit the enchanting Kumarakom Bird Sanctuary or take a houseboat tour along the backwaters to experience Alleppey's beauty from a different perspective.

To maximize your fun, make sure to try local delicacies like spicy fish curry, banana chips, and fresh coconut water. Engage with the locals to learn about their traditions and customs. Don't forget to capture plenty of photos to cherish the memories of your Alleppey adventure.

Time and Costs Estimates

  • Alleppey Beach (2 hours, free)
  • Nehru Trophy Boat Race (2 hours, free)
  • Alleppey Backwaters (4 hours, boat tour prices vary)
  • Krishnapuram Palace (1 hour, ₹50 for adults)
  • Alappuzha Lighthouse (1 hour, ₹20 for adults)
  • Alleppey Canals (1 hour, boat tour prices vary)
  • Alleppey Market (1 hour, prices vary based on purchases)
  • Total Estimated Costs: ₹70 per person (excluding boat tour prices and market purchases)
